**Key Ceremony Checklist — Item 12 (RemindWell Clinic Job)**

As the incoming contractor for the RemindWell appointment-reminder job at Haleford Health, you participate in the quarterly key ceremony even if you won't rotate keys yourself. Verify the reminder job's encryption keypair is generated on the air-gapped workstation, witnessed by two staff, and escrowed in the sealed envelope. Before signing the ceremony record, test the escrow unlock once. The unlock prompt requires the recovery passphrase printed just below this item.

strongbox words: norwyn-wenael-aldvan-aldiel-wendor-holael

Facilities ticket — Night shift, Brindlecote Campus. Twenty-two interns from the Fennhollow programme arrive tomorrow at 08:00. Please unlock seminar rooms B2 and B3 by 06:30, set chairs to classroom layout, and confirm the water coolers on level one are refilled. Leave the loading bay clear for their equipment van. Overnight access to the prep corridor requires the pass code below.

badge for bajop-yawep: bdg-NNHEW-6

**Q: Why does Harkspool cap database connections at 40?**

Because the Ostermere cluster falls over past that, honestly. The pool recycles idle connections after 90 seconds; don't raise the cap without load-testing. If the pool manager wedges and won't restart cleanly, you'll hit its recovery prompt — at that prompt, enter the passphrase shown directly below.

recovery phrase for bawep-kawef: oliath-casdor

Changed defaults in Splitfork, our assignment service. Bucketing now uses sticky hashing per account instead of per session, and the holdout slice grew from 2% to 5%. Callers relying on session-level reassignment must opt in explicitly. Review the diff against the new baseline; the updated default configuration is listed below.

config for tagep-kajof:
[casir]
port = 6379
region = south-1
host = casir.paliqdyn.example
team = tamax
timeout_ms = 250
retries = 2